WebApr 16, 2024 · The main reason for orchid leaves turning yellow is root rot from overwatering and results from slow-draining soil. If too much moisture is present, it can be from using ordinary potting soil and moss. The potting medium retains moisture, and the roots do not get oxygen. WebJan 5, 2024 · 2. Water quality. Orchids can be picky about water quality. Hard water, well water, or water with excess amounts of chlorine, salt, or fluoride can turn leaves brown. Other parts of the plant may be damaged as well, like the margins, stems, or tips. Using filtered or rainwater is the best solution.

WebOverwatering an orchid plant is extremely dangerous to the plant's health. Too much water stops oxygen from reaching the roots. Orchid roots exposed to excessive water begin to rot, turning brown to black, and become extremely soft. ...
